Description

Skeletons are discovered in a wasteland behind Cockpit Lane, a poor and largely black area of inner south London. DCI David Brock and DS Kathy Kolla of Scotland Yard's Serious Crime Branch are called in to investigate. The discovery that the victims died during the Brixton riots over 20 years ago leads Brock and Kolla on a dark and dangerous journey in which past and present come together in an intricate web of deception and intrigue.

Author Bio

Barry Maitland was born in Scotland and raised in London. He studied at Cambridge and moved to Australia to become Professor of Architecture at the University of Newcastle. He has since retired to pursue his writing. Maitland's The Marx Sisters was nominated for the John Creasey Award for Best First Novel and The Malcontenta won the Ned Kelly Award for Best Crime Fiction. No Trace is his eighth Brock and Kolla mystery.
